The 20.8m/68'3" motor yacht 'The One' by the Italian shipyard Azimut offers flexible accommodation for up to 8 guests in 4 cabins and features interior styling by Italian designer Carlo Galeazzi.
Built in 2017, The One is a luxury charter dream, offering excellent indoor and outdoor spaces sure to delight guests.
The One offers guest accommodation for up to 8 guests in 4 suites comprising two double cabins and two twin cabins.
The One benefits from some excellent features to improve your charter, notably Wi-Fi connectivity, allowing you to stay connected at all times, should you wish. Guests will experience complete comfort while chartering thanks to air conditioning.
The One is built with a GRP hull and carbon fibre superstructure. The One comfortably cruises at 25 knots, reaches a maximum speed of 32 knots. Her low draft of 1.6m/5'3" makes her primed for accessing shallow areas and cruising close to the shorelines.
